I've recently rented some time on an Imacon Flextight 4x5 Scanner using the Flexcolor software for scanning. In order to have the most flexibility for each scan I decided to scan my film in the 3F format and later process them on my computer using the Flexcolor software. I usually work in the ProPhoto RGB color space so that is how I have my output settings configured. The scans from the first day processed correctly. The scans I made from the 2nd day I rented time, will only process in the Adobe 1998 color space. I don't remember if I changed the output RGB setting from Adobe 1998 to Prophoto RGB before I made these scans. However, I was under the impression that it wouldn't matter because I was scanning in the 3F format, which is basically a RAW format with no settings applied. I figured the color space would be attached at the time of processing. I having quadruple checked the output setting on my Flexcolor software before processing 3F files to make sure it's set on Prophoto RGB. I don't know if I'm missing something, or if there is another option somewhere I'm missing with the processing. Can anyone out there enlighten me with their knowledge on this issue?
